GENERAL WARNING: Due to intermittent problems with the temperature signal for the Guildline CTD the quality of temperature and salinity data is doubtful. Investigators are encouraged to read the processing report before using this data. Casts for which severe problems were noted have special warnings in the headers. The salinity should be considered to be +/-0.01units at best and errors as large as 0.25units of salinity have been noted.
